MARKET INSIGHTS
The Global Virgin Polyester Staple Fiber market size was valued at USD 28.3 billion in 2023 and is projected to reach USD 41.1 billion by 2030, exhibiting a Compound Annual Growth Rate (CAGR) of 5.2% during the forecast period (2023-2030).
Virgin Polyester Staple Fiber (VPSF) is a synthetic fiber derived directly from purified terephthalic acid (PTA) or dimethyl terephthalate (DMT) and monoethylene glycol (MEG), without any recycled content. This high-performance fiber is widely used across industries due to its durability, moisture-wicking properties, and chemical resistance. Key applications span apparel, automotive interiors, home textiles, construction materials, and personal care products.
The market growth is driven by expanding textile industries in Asia-Pacific and increasing demand for lightweight automotive components. However, rising environmental concerns about synthetic fibers are prompting manufacturers to invest in sustainable production methods. Recent developments include Indorama Ventures' 2023 expansion of VPSF production capacity in Thailand to meet growing global demand, particularly for high-tenacity fibers used in technical textiles.

Outlook: The Future of Global Virgin Polyester Staple Fiber Market
The trajectory of the VPSF market is shaped by the convergence of cost competitiveness and environmental stewardship. While the apparel sector continues to drive volume, the automotive and construction segments are accelerating adoption of high‑performance fibers that deliver weight savings and improved insulation. Emerging markets in Southeast Asia and Africa are unlocking new demand curves as local textile manufacturing expands and disposable incomes rise. Companies that can blend technical innovation with sustainable production practices will likely capture the most significant market share in the coming decade.
Future Trends Shaping the Market
- Technology‑Enabled Sustainability: Closed‑loop manufacturing and bio‑based feedstocks are becoming mainstream, reducing the carbon footprint of VPSF production.
- Technical Textile Expansion: Hollow and specialty fibers are increasingly deployed in automotive interiors, aerospace, and high‑performance sportswear, commanding premium pricing.
- Regulatory Momentum: Environmental regulations, particularly in the EU and China, are tightening requirements for microplastic shedding and carbon intensity, pushing firms toward cleaner technologies.
- Supply Chain Resilience: Diversification of raw material sourcing and the adoption of digital supply‑chain platforms are mitigating the impact of geopolitical volatility.
